Interesting fact
The Kazimierz I Odnowiciel coin was designed by Polish artist and sculptor, Stanisława Wątróbska-Frindt, and it features an image of King Kazimierz I Odnowiciel on the obverse side, while the reverse side features the coat of arms of Poland. The coin was minted in 1980 as a trial strike, which means that it was not officially released into circulation, but rather produced as a test run to check the quality and design of the coin. As a result, only a limited number of these coins were minted, making them quite rare and valuable among collectors.
